In Sparks, Nevada, the process of drywall installation often begins with the careful measuring and cutting of gypsum panels to fit the framing of a new room or renovation. Licensed pros start by ensuring the wall studs or ceiling joists are properly spaced for the chosen drywall thickness. They then hang the panels, screwing them into the framing with precision to avoid over-driving the fasteners. The next critical step is taping the seams between panels and covering any screw or nail heads with joint compound, often called 'mud.' This initial coat seals the joints and fasteners. Subsequent coats of mud are applied, feathering out the edges to create a smooth transition and a level surface. Finally, the entire area is sanded to a smooth finish, preparing it for paint or other wall coverings. What affects the price

Drywall projects vary based on a few main factors. The total square footage, the height of your ceilings, and the level of finish required—like smooth wall versus textured—are the biggest drivers. If your walls have significant water damage or require mold remediation, that adds complexity. Accessibility also matters; tight corners or areas requiring scaffolding take more time than open rooms. About this service

Drywall finishes refer to the final level of smoothness applied to your walls. They range from a rough, utilitarian level meant for garages to a 'Level 5' finish, which is perfectly smooth and ideal for high-gloss paint or bright lighting. Choosing the right finish depends on your aesthetic goals and the room’s function. Higher levels require more labor and sanding. Costs depend on the level of detail requested.

What's the best way to patch a small hole in drywall?

For small drywall holes in Sparks, like those from a nail pop or minor impact, a self-adhesive patch or a small piece of drywall is typically used. The area around the hole is cleaned, the patch is applied, and then multiple thin layers of joint compound are applied over the patch and feathered out. Sanding between coats ensures a smooth, invisible repair.

What kind of drywall is best for fire resistance?

Fire-resistant drywall, often called Type X, is designed to provide an extra layer of protection against fire. It typically contains glass fibers in its core, making it denser and more resistant to burning. This type of drywall is crucial for certain areas of a home or commercial building in Sparks where fire safety codes require it. Professionals can determine if this is needed for your project.

What are the different drywall thicknesses available?

Drywall panels come in various thicknesses, with 1/2 inch being the most common for walls and ceilings in residential construction throughout Sparks. Thicker options, like 5/8 inch, offer greater strength, better sound insulation, and enhanced fire resistance. Thinner panels, such as 1/4 inch, are often used for repairs or curved surfaces. The pros will select the appropriate thickness for your specific application.

What is all-purpose drywall mud?

All-purpose drywall mud is a pre-mixed joint compound suitable for various drywall tasks, including taping, filling, and finishing. It's convenient for smaller jobs and DIYers in Sparks, as it's ready to use straight from the container. While it's versatile, professionals may use different types of mud for specific applications to achieve optimal results, especially for large-scale projects.

How do you spackle small holes in drywall?

Spackling small holes in drywall is a straightforward process. First, clean the area around the hole. Then, apply a small amount of spackle with a putty knife, pressing it into the hole. Smooth the surface, removing any excess. Once dry, lightly sand it smooth. For larger holes, multiple applications might be needed. This is a common repair handled by the pros.

What are drywall panels?

Drywall panels, often referred to as sheetrock, are the large, flat sheets made from gypsum plaster that form the interior surfaces of walls and ceilings. They are attached to the building's framing. The seams between these panels, along with fastener heads, are then covered with joint compound and tape to create a smooth, continuous surface ready for painting or texturing in any Sparks home.
